Cameroon-India Trade: In 2022, Cameroon exported $974M to India. The main products that Cameroon exported to India were Crude Petroleum ($702M), Petroleum Gas ($223M), and Raw Cotton ($31.7M). Over the past 5 years the exports of Cameroon to India have increased at an annualized rate of 33.3%, from $232M in 2017 to $974M in 2022.

In 2022, Cameroon did not export any services to India.

India-Cameroon Trade: In 2022, India exported $492M to Cameroon. The main products that India exported to Cameroon were Rice ($175M), Packaged Medicaments ($53M), and Raw Sugar ($24.8M). Over the past 5 years the exports of India to Cameroon have increased at an annualized rate of 12.1%,  from $221M in 2017 to $492M in 2022.

In 2022, India did not export any services to Cameroon.

Comparison: In 2022,  Cameroon ranked 113 in the Economic Complexity Index (ECI -1.01), and 117 in total exports ($6.95B). That same year, India ranked 40 in the Economic Complexity Index (ECI 0.64), and 15 in total exports ($468B).
